A short-term goal is something you want to do in the near future. The near future can mean today, this week, this month, or even this year. A short-term goal is something you want to accomplish soon. Something that will take you a long time to accomplish is called a long-term goal.
Why is it important to set short term and long-term goals?
Short terms goals act as a milestone in your journey to reach the long term goal of your life. They help you gauge how far you have come and how long you still have to travel to reach your ultimate destination. Also, to achieve the long term goals, you need to break them down into short term goals.

Which is better to set long term goals or short term goals?
A series of short-term goals, that inevitably lead to the long-term goal or vision, is much more effective. By definition, short-term goals are easier to achieve than long-term goals – and this is a good thing! When we achieve the goals we set ourselves, our confidence in our ability to achieve bigger goals grows.
What’s the difference between short term and enabling goals?
Short-term goals are ones that a person will achieve in the near future, typically in less than one year. Short-term goals are often, but not always, steppingstones on the way to achieving long-term goals. These types of goals are considered enabling goals because accomplishment of these goals will “enable” you to achieve an even greater goal.
